AMD Ryzen 9 9950X at maximum power consumption,
which are 230 W. In particular, we are talking about some performance tests in Blender, where the Ryzen 9 9950X, the top processor of the Ryzen 9000 family, was tested at various power levels.

In particular, it is indicated that AMD Ryzen 9 9950X at 230 W managed to reach the maximum frequency
5620 MHz with a very good temperature of 62ºC. Of course, the energy costs to achieve this frequency are very high, since at 160 W able to achieve
5.555 MHz at 58°C. On the completely opposite side, it is indicated that it is necessary to limit its consumption only 60 watts able to achieve 4.048 MHz
with a very low temperature of 41°C. In fact, this means that it can be implemented even on a mini PC.

He AMD Ryzen 9 9950X This is the company’s best processor in the configuration 16 cores and 32 processing threads under architecture AMD Zen 5These cores are capable of reaching turbo frequencies. 5.70 GHz together with TDP 170 W. In this case, we will start talking about its performance of 230 W, which allows us to achieve 5620 MHzOf course, this is an engineering sample, so this processor really should reach 5.70 GHzwhich is its official turbo frequency.

With this power consumption, this processor showed a performance of 353 points in the Monster test, 226 in Junkshop and 171 in Classroom. What does this data translate into? where does the AMD Ryzen 9 9950X offer up to 33.5% more productivity
compared to the Intel Core i9-14900. Compared to its predecessor, the Ryzen 9 7950X, also with 230W, this is the performance difference
amounts to 27.6%.

Perhaps the most interesting thing is that Ryzen 9 9950X Limited to 120W offers almost similar performance to this Intel Core i9-14900K with a consumption of 253W. Even with a limit of 90W, the Ryzen 9 9950X is faster than the Ryzen 9 5950X (142W). Limited to 60W.performs almost as well as the Intel Core i9-12900K (241W).

Using this entry, we add to AMD Ryzen 9 9900Xa 12-core, 24-thread version that was spotted in a test involving the CPU-Z tool. In it, it gave an insight into 878.1 points, single core and performance 13,572 points, multi-core.

In performance multi-core this translates as stay
between Intel Core i7-14700K (14,904 points)
and Intel Core i7-13700K (12,258 points). The Intel Core i9-14900KS processor leads this test (17,992 points).

In performance single core Things aren’t getting any better either. This processor is located in the middle is Intel Core i9-13900K (899 points) and Core i7-13700K (875 points). The Intel Core i9-14900KS also leads here with 933 points.
